Due Diligence Considerations

When evaluating Textwork as an acquisition candidate, buyers should investigate several key areas. First, understand the specific AI technologies powering the platform—whether Textwork has proprietary models, uses third-party APIs like OpenAI, or employs open-source solutions. This affects pricing sustainability, competitive positioning, and technology risk.

Second, analyze the customer composition and retention rates. With $1,905 MRR, understanding how many customers generate this revenue and their churn patterns is critical for forecasting post-acquisition performance. Customer concentration risk (reliance on one or two large clients) could significantly impact valuation.

Third, evaluate the marketing channels driving the current 201 monthly visitors. Are these organic search results, content marketing, paid advertising, or partnership channels? The traffic sources indicate whether demand is sustainable or highly dependent on continuous spending.

Finally, assess the team behind Textwork. Founder background, technical capabilities, and willingness to stay post-acquisition influence integration success. For AI companies specifically, technical team retention often determines whether the acquisition value is realized.
